Vienna Airport customer review

(Norway)

Arrival OK bussed to the gate butthat's pretty normal with low-cost carriers here. Once inside met by airport employees giving out tourist booklets. Some waiting for luggage but nothing too bad. Out through customs slightly cramped and signage could be better. Signs to the train steers you towards the airport train which is the same as S-Bahn but costs much more: make sure you go for the S-Bahn it is very easy to miss. Departure: if you arrive by train (whether S-Bahn or CAT) you have to go through the arrivals area and a narrow corridor to find an elevator to departures: suboptimal. But the worst part was that our flight to Oslo was not on the screens! It turned out that low-cost carriers have a separate check-in building across the road from the main terminal. Though HG flights which also have to be checked in in that building are on the screens. There is basically no information on that: very bad. Once we found the check-in desk and dropped the luggage (which went reasonably fast) the rest was OK. Security is at the gate so you go first to a very decent selection of shops and cafes. The ground-floor boarding area (the bus-gates) is shambolic though lots of flights with probably three security channels and while the security people were doing their best there was some queuing. Once in it's very packed and there is a pretty useless shop wedged in between the gates so there were two chaotic queues trying to get through some very narrow space. Overall: does the job but needs work in many areas. Good shopping though.

Vienna Airport customer review

(Norway)

The airport gets more and more crowded and is awaiting the opening of the new terminal which will approximately double its capacity sadly the building site has been stopped due to financial difficulties so it looks like this will be available only in two years or so. In my opinion Vienna airport is outdated and generally very unsightly (tasteless and very much patched together interiors). I think there is a general lack of seating here. Prices at bars and restaurants are outrageous. Considering this is their hub the C lounge facilities offered by Austrian Airlines are unimpressive. The new CAT service (City Airport Train) to/from Vienna is a joke - it has roughly the same frequency and transport time as the suburban train (S-Bahn) but charges three times its fare. The VIAS security staff - responsible for everyone's security scans is rude and speaks very little English - hard to believe such badly trained staff should be responsible for security. Check-in for StarAlliance and AirBerlin/NIKI passengers can be done in the city centre. Terminal check-in has plenty of machines but Y service can be a bit temperamental. Waiting times and walking distances are very short transferring between the most remote gates does not take more than 10-15 minutes. The luggage delivery is great - I never waited for more than 15 minutes after getting off the plane. Transport to and from Vienna is excellent and inexpensive. S-Bahn (3 Euro) or my favourite - the 15 minute bus ride to very central Schwedenplatz for 6 Euro.

Vienna Airport customer review

(Austria)

Vienna Airport has gone very much downhill. For Star Alliance airlines (Swiss Austrian etc) there is no check-in anymore. You are supposed to use the check-in computers (just look for the rugby rummage and elbow your way to the front). If there is a problem with your booking (the system decided to change mine to make my connecting flight 12 hours before my initial flight) then everything takes longer again. Forget time-saving - the "new improved" system takes forever. If you have a bag which is not standard size you are sent to another queue where you are billed 8 Euros for each piece of luggage to go through the x-ray machine. Once inside the departure area the shops' prices explode! Buy an iced-tea and a small toasted sandwich (optimistically given the name of 'panino') and wave goodbye to another 8 Euros. Take your snack to the table needing the least cleaning (dishes piled up everywhere - dirty tables GROSS). All other shops have crazy prices. I will definitely be avoiding this airport in the future. I flew on a day where not many people flew and everything still took ages.

Vienna Airport customer review

Fair to good. On arrival a bit chaotic to be mixed with departing passengers and the sea of yellow hoardings is a good stress raiser. Baggage retrieval efficient. Route to CAT and S-Bahn a bit tortuous and you have to be determined to get to the S-Bahn. Absence of ticket office and only two S-Bahn machines a bit painful - though there is another ticket machine at platform level. Don't forget to validate the ticket! Check-in and security calm and efficient on return journey.

Vienna Airport customer review

I arrived on transit in the Schengen area and needed a farmacy. I was surprised to hear that the pharmacy was outside the security area and that it was already closed at 7.00 pm! My onward flight was at 11.20 pm to BKK so I had to change to Terminal C (Non Schengen). As there were nearly no other flights after 8.00 pm nearly all shops were closed very boaring. I strongly can recommend all passengers to stay in the Schengen area till one hour before their flight from Terminal C. Also the Star Alliance business lounge in the Main Terminal has a lot more to offer than the lounge in C.
